Q. A beam of monochromatic green light is diffracted by a slit of width 0.60-mm. The diffraction pattern forms on a wall 2.06 m further than the slit. The distance between the positions of zero intensity on both sides of the central bright fringe is 3.70 mm. Estimate the wavelength of the light.
